How to Track ROI in Digital Marketing Campaigns

 In the digital world, businesses often ask one important question:

πŸ‘‰ “Are my marketing efforts actually making me money?”

That’s where ROI (Return on Investment) comes in. Tracking ROI helps you measure how much revenue your digital marketing campaigns generate compared to how much you spend. Without it, you’re simply guessing whether your strategy is working.


πŸ”Ή What is ROI in Digital Marketing?

ROI in digital marketing is the profit gained from your campaigns compared to the cost invested.

The basic formula is:

ROI (%) = (Revenue – Marketing Cost) ÷ Marketing Cost × 100

πŸ’‘ Example: If you spend Rs. 100,000 on a campaign and generate Rs. 300,000 in sales, your ROI is 200%.


πŸ”Ή Why Tracking ROI is Important

  • Helps you identify which campaigns drive sales and which waste money.

  • Allows you to optimize marketing budgets for better results.

  • Builds transparency for stakeholders and clients.

  • Guides data-driven decisions instead of assumptions.


πŸ”Ή Steps to Track ROI in Digital Marketing

1. Define Clear Goals

Before calculating ROI, set measurable goals such as:

  • Increasing website traffic

  • Generating leads

  • Boosting online sales

  • Improving brand awareness

Without clear KPIs (Key Performance Indicators), ROI tracking becomes vague.


2. Assign Monetary Value to Conversions

Not all conversions are equal. Assign a value to each:

  • Lead Generation: If 1 out of 10 leads becomes a customer worth Rs. 50,000, then each lead is worth Rs. 5,000.

  • E-Commerce: The value is the total sales generated.

  • Subscriptions: Calculate the lifetime value of each subscriber.


3. Use Tracking Tools & Analytics

Digital tools make ROI tracking easier.

  • Google Analytics 4 (GA4): Tracks website traffic, conversions, and revenue.

  • Google Ads Conversion Tracking: Measures ROI from ad campaigns.

  • Facebook Pixel: Tracks ROI from Facebook and Instagram campaigns.

  • CRM Tools (HubSpot, Zoho, Salesforce): Connect sales data with marketing campaigns.


4. Track All Campaign Costs

ROI isn’t just about ad spend—it includes:

  • Agency fees

  • Employee salaries (if in-house)

  • Marketing tools/software subscriptions

  • Content creation (design, copywriting, video)

πŸ’‘ Tip: The more accurate your cost calculation, the clearer your ROI picture.


5. Attribute Revenue to the Right Channel

Use multi-touch attribution models to understand where sales come from:

  • First Click Attribution: Credits the first interaction (e.g., Google search).

  • Last Click Attribution: Credits the final step before conversion (e.g., email link).

  • Linear Attribution: Splits credit across all touchpoints.

This helps you identify which channel (SEO, ads, social media) delivers the best ROI.


6. Monitor ROI Regularly

Tracking ROI is not a one-time task. Review it:

  • Weekly for ad campaigns

  • Monthly for SEO

  • Quarterly for overall strategy

Regular monitoring allows you to tweak underperforming campaigns before losing money.


πŸ”Ή Common Challenges in Tracking ROI

  • Difficulty in tracking offline conversions (phone calls, store visits)

  • Long sales cycles where leads convert months later

  • Inconsistent tracking setup across platforms

πŸ’‘ Solution: Use CRM integration and proper conversion tracking setup to minimize gaps.


πŸ”Ή Final Thoughts

Tracking ROI in digital marketing is crucial to understand what’s working and what’s not. By setting clear goals, assigning value to conversions, using analytics tools, and monitoring regularly, businesses can maximize their marketing investments.

πŸ‘‰ At Mega Marketing Network, we help businesses in Karachi and worldwide set up ROI tracking systems that ensure every rupee spent is measurable, accountable, and profitable.

Comments

Popular posts from this blog

E-commerce Marketing in Karachi – Boost Sales Locally & Globally

Shopify vs. WooCommerce – Which is Better?

Digital Marketing in Karachi and How Mega Marketing Network Helps USA Clients